About Fran
Fran Goldstein CPC CSP has three decades of recruiting and sales success. As a teenager in High School she sold cosmetics in a local Cincinnati pharmacy after school and proceeded to sell for Victoria's Secret and Tupperware. Each position resulted in leading sales production and promotions to management. With a college degree in BS from Syracuse University Fran discovered recruiting as a transition from Social Work. Recruiting became Fran's passion and lead her to continued success as she was promoted to management, Regional Manager and in 1993 she established Gold Staff Consultants, a blended placement firm specializing in administrative support. As CEO, Fran grew the blended firm to a multimillion dollar entity. In 2004, in response to colleague's requests for training, she launched a speaking, training & consulting division, FranSpeaks. As a result of Fran's unique energy, down to earth style and passion for mentoring, she coaches CEOs and sales leaders while speaking, training and mentoring recruiters and sales teams internationally.
Fran served on the Board of Directors of NAPS (National Association of Personnel Services) for many years. She was the recipient of the 2005 & 2007 Chairman's Award for her leadership and contributions to the association. She is also Past President of MAPS (Massachusetts Association of Personnel Services) and Past Vice President of MSA (Massachusetts Staffing Association). In 2007 Fran was elected to serve on the Board of Directors for the National Speakers Association of New England and was honored with the David Fitzgerald Spirit Award. In 2008 Fran was selected Chapter Member of the Year, and is now serving as President for the 2009-2010 year. She lives in the greater Boston area with her husband Robert.
